I know this won't be a hard find but not planning a city shopping trip so I thought I would see what your guys thoughts are.

Need a fridge and stove.

White.
Stove can be coil top. does not need to be digital but can be.
Fridge size needs to be 20 cubs or slightly larger.
Prefer fridge on top.
will be plumbed for ice. Ice dispenser not needed No water dispense required.
Would prefer USA made. Good quality.
would like to buy as a pair if possible. Not a requirement.

Price? under $1000 for fridge. $6-700 stove. Cheaper, better. Thoughts.

Maytag MRT311FFFH and the icemaker is W11517113

Their top mounts are made in Mexico but they have been solid for us

Range I would go with a Ceran (smooth top) Selection is limited on coil burner models and really not much cheaper.

I would buy Amana range AER6603SFW. It's made in Oklahoma.

Both brands are part of Whirlpool
